Welcome, plugin authors. The TumbleVault locker flow works like this: a resident scans their tag, our gateway issues a short-lived grant, and your plugin confirms the drop-off or pickup. Your plugin must respond within four seconds or the locker re-locks. All grant payloads you emit must be signed before the gateway will accept them, using the key shown below.

release key, hadug-kawef: bky13_mPGeFZeR1GZ1G

// Notes for the weekly eng sync re: Gallerywhisper, our museum audio-guide app.
// This constant sets the prefetch radius for exhibit audio clips. At the
// Hollen Pavilion pilot we learned visitors walk faster than our original
// estimate, so clips were buffering mid-stride. Bumping this to three rooms
// ahead fixed it, at a modest bandwidth cost. Don't lower it without testing
// on the slow gallery wifi first — seriously, it's painful. The trace token
// from the pilot build that validated this number is appended just below.

trace token, kahap-bagaf: htk4_8458

# Break-Glass: PortionPal Scaling Calculator

If PortionPal's admin console locks everyone out (it happens — ask Marisol about the Great Sourdough Incident), you can still reach the recovery shell on the scaler box. This bypasses SSO entirely, so only use it when the team is truly stuck. Log the incident in the runbook afterward, no exceptions. The shell prompts for the emergency passphrase before granting access. You'll find the current passphrase directly below.

unlock words, faweg-fahop: wendor-kelmir-ulaeth-holael